Python3,网站搭建之构建Flask项目,带你启动web服务! !

编程知识 更新时间:2023-04-05 15:58:05

接着上一篇《Python3,网站搭建之数据库表设计及数据存储!》
这一篇继续来搭建我们的网站,
今天来分享的内容,是构建Flask项目。

构建Flask项目

    • 1. 初始化app
    • 2. 启动app
    • 3. 参考文献

1. 初始化app

因为要构建flask项目,
所以第一步,需要安装flask~

pip install flask

安装完成,我们就老规矩,上代码:

Servers 文件夹下的 init.py:

# -*- coding: utf-8 -*-
"""
@ auth : carl_DJ
@ time : 2020-9-02
"""

'''
初始化app,
主要放置前端内容,例如:js,css等

'''
from flask import Flask

#初始化app实例对象
app  = Flask(__name__,
			#指定前端文件夹templates
			template_folder = '../Services/templates',
			#前端css,js等代码放置在static文件夹下
			static_folder='../Services/templates/static'
			)


看一下目录结构


这里也给大家标注出来了:

templates:放置前端代码
main.py:启动app
init.py:初始化app

2. 启动app

1.编写main.py文件的代码

main.py

# -*- coding: utf-8 -*-
"""
@ auth : carl_DJ
@ time : 2020-9-02
"""
from Servers import app

#启动app
if  __name__ == "__mian__":
	'''
	设置host,
	设置 port
	开启debug模式,如果报错,在前端直接显示
	'''
	app.run(host = 0.0.0.0,
			port = 8889,
			debug = True)

2.运行main.py文件的代码

如果出现截图的信息,说明没问题。

3.点击网址http://0.0.0.0:8889

出现截图的现象,说明没问题:

此时,
小屌丝疑惑的问:鱼叔,这都出现了无法访问此页面,你还说没问题??
小鱼:不要慌,千万不要慌,出现这个现象,是正确的, 因为咱不是没有写获取数据的api接口嘛!
小屌丝:那,获取数据的 api接口,怎么写呢,是不是写了接口,就可以显示正常了?
**小鱼:**你写了获取api接口,要是数据库没数据,一样显示不了数据,
只有数据库有数据,而且还写api接口,并且都没问题,才能显示出想要的效果哦~ ~ ~
小屌丝: 那赶紧的,我要看效果…
小鱼:别着急,我们下一篇《Python3,网站搭建之编写API接口》见。

3. 参考文献

如果对Flask不太了解的,可以参考这篇就够:
>> w3cschool提供的《Flask 教程》

更多推荐

Python3,网站搭建之构建Flask项目,带你启动web服务! !

本文发布于:2023-04-05 15:58:00,感谢您对本站的认可!
本文链接:https://www.elefans.com/category/jswz/4d86fd80aca706c54274d2fd3e2ef2ae.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
本文标签:带你   项目   网站   web   Flask

发布评论

评论列表 (有 0 条评论)
草根站长

>www.elefans.com

编程频道|电子爱好者 - 技术资讯及电子产品介绍!

  • 46769文章数
  • 14阅读数
  • 0评论数